Scenario:



Consider the following scenario modelling project, manager, specialist engineer, quality supervisor, and the like at an organization.

A project manager is responsible for a project. He is uniquely identified by a id. A project manager has a name, specialization, experience and details of projects. A project manager can supervise one or more projects. Each project has a unique id, a project name, duration and total cost. A project can have only one project manager. Each project has a quality supervisor. A quality supervisor has unique id, name, designation and certification details. A quality supervisor may or may not be assigned to any project or can be assigned to more than one project. A group of specialist engineers work for a project. Each specialist engineer has a unique id, name, specialization and experience. A specialist engineer can work for more than one project at a time. However, he should work for at least one project. A specialist engineer reports to one or more


project managers. A project manager may not be having any specialist engineers reporting to him. Each business group may have many projects or may not be having any projects. A business group is identified by a name. A business group has focus area and description. One or more project managers belong to a business group. Each business group should have at least one project manager. A business head handles one more business groups. However, a business group has exactly one business head. A business group head has a name, position name and address.


Task 1: Construct the Entity Relationship Diagram (ERD) for the above given scenario. Identify the different entities, the attributes of each entity including the Primary key, not null, relationship between the entities and the integrity constraints.


Task 2: Normalize the below given resource allocation information into First Normal Form, Second Normal Form and Third Normal Form. Indicate primary key and foreign key.


A resource allocation sheet prepared for every project. Resource allocation contains the details of the engineer along with the number of days that an engineer works for the project. A project is assigned a unique identity number and each project will be carried out for a customer.


Resource Allocation document ID : 2244
Project ID: 1122
Customer ID: 255
Project Name: MP3 Codec
Customer Name: Oman Audio Solutions
Employee ID Employee Name Designation Number of Days
1021 Ali Project Manager 40
2109 Basher Analyst 60
1208 Nada Programmer 45





Task 3:

Write the SQL statements of the following:
i. Create the tables that you identified in Task 2. Include different identity constraints (e.g. primary key, foreign key, not null, integrity constraints etc.).
ii. Insert two records each to any table you created in Task (3 i)
iii. Write a SQL query to display the employee id of engineers whose name has last character/alphabet ‘a’ and project name is ‘Mp3 Codec’ (Refer Task 2

).
